Title: Piero della Francesca - The Arezzo Cycle - Battle between Constantine and Maxentius (Detail) (Artwork) Summary: This artwork is part of a series known as 'The Arezzo Cycle' by the renowned Italian painter, Piero della Francesca. The Battle between Constantine and Maxentius is one of its detailed scenes. Created in the early 15th century, this masterpiece illustrates a significant event from Christian history - the pivotal battle that took place in 312 AD between Roman Emperor Constantine and his rival Maxentius, which is often associated with the Christianization of the Roman Empire. The artwork showcases Piero della Francesca's exceptional skill in perspective and realistic representation, making it a valuable contribution to the history of art.
